    After riding a street glide 32,000 miles in a year and a half, and then trading to a road glide, i am indeed convinced the road glide DOES handle better. The fairing weight being fixed to the frame makes the handling so much smoother. if you're not looking for every ounce of performance, it just boils down to what you like riding and looking at!!     as an owner of a road glide and a street glide, the road glide is more maneuverable than the street. you definitely feel the weight of the fairing of the street on slow speed turns and if you're not ready for it, it will surprise you. i was a street glide all the way until my road glide. now, if i'm doing distance, the RG is my choice. my SG is my local cruiser/bar hopper. if you do go with the street, you should think about the Electra glide standard to mod out. granted it won't be blacked out and have the 107, but it would be a blank canvas. I'd choose the RG.

    I was going to build up my Heritage to more touring, but ended up getting the Street Glide. I also felt the Road Glide felt bulky and not as "every day" as the Street Glide. I went with the Freedom Shields windshield, they are less expensive, very thick and sturdy, made here in America, and also let you try it out for a while to make sure it is what you want. I also went with 10" bars to put my arms level with my shoulders, and changed out the rear shocks with the SuperShox (one of my best upgrades). I put Harley's premium ride cartridges in the front, but I'll be switching those out. They aren't as good as others they compete against. I should have known better to begin with. For reference, mine is a 2014 FLHXS I bought new. I've only got about 32k miles on it now unfortunately as I haven't been able to ride much the last couple years. Hopefully that'll change soon.

    I ended up going with a 2019 Sport Glide. I'm not a huge fan of the fairing, but I didn't need all the bells and whistles that came with the big touring bikes. I also liked the fact I could strip it down to a bar hopper in about 5 minutes. The trunks and fairing on it pop right off, I don't even use the fairing unless I'm going for longer rides and looking at changing it up cause I want to change the handle bars. The trunks fit my gear and laptop bag. I do like the navs on the bigger touring bikes though, I just wanted a street bike that could ride long if needed. The low rider, which I had my eye on, didn't have the easy monospring adjustment or cruise control, plus I liked the inverted forks. Which I understand the 2020 Low Riders switched to.
